Massive Black Hole Discovered in Milky Way’s Satellite Galaxy

- A groundbreaking study reveals that the Large Magellanic Cloud, our Milky Way's satellite galaxy, may harbor a colossal supermassive black hole, tipping the scales at 600,000 solar masses. By examining hypervelocity stars linked to the LMC, researchers are on the brink of a discovery that could transform our grasp of the galaxy's formation and evolution.
